There are several good restaurants in Ponteland but our favourite is probably Cafe Lowery [a mile from the village centre on the shopping arcade at Broadway within the Darras Hall Estate]. The menu probably needs updating as it's been the same on our last 3 visits but there's enough choice to ring the changes.
Would recommend splashing out on a starter [especially the spinach and cheese souffle!] and a main course rather than a pudding- as the puddings aren't very exciting.
Pleasant house wines and good coffee and friendly, attentive service.
